Medication Technician (Med Tech) - Assisted Living Community Job Summary: We are seeking a compassionate and detail-oriented Medication Technician (Med Tech) to join our team at Meadow Falls of Middletown, an Assisted Living Community in Middletown, OH. As a Med Tech, you will play a critical role in resident health and safety by administering medications accurately and on time, while supporting overall well-being. Key Responsibilities: Administer medications to residents following physician orders and established procedures Document medication administration accurately (MAR/eMAR) Observe residents for side effects or changes in condition and report concerns to the nurse or supervisor Maintain proper storage, handling, and disposal of medications Ensure medication carts and records are organized and compliant Communicate effectively with nursing staff, caregivers, and families Follow infection control and safety protocols Qualifications: High school diploma or equivalent required Current Medication Technician certification (per state requirements) CPR/First Aid certification preferred Previous experience in assisted living or long-term care preferred Strong attention to detail and ability to follow procedures Skills & Traits: Compassionate and patient-centered approach Strong organizational and time-management skills Ability to multitask in a fast-paced environment Good communication and observation skills Physical Requirements: Ability to stand, walk, bend, and assist residents Ability to lift up to 25-50 lbs as needed Why This Role Matters: The Med Tech plays a critical role in resident health and safety by ensuring medications are administered accurately and on time, while supporting overall well-being.
